I've been working on a separate mini-series to build a ttl-uart from scratch, in this video I integrate the UART into the main cpu build to run it through it's paces but also to get an opportunity to test the cpu with the lcd display limiting the clock.

After some basics tests of send and receive I convert the prime number finding demo to use the serial port and make it generate all the 16bit primes as fast as my current clock will allow it.
